Output 893bc2196c58cbaf14c616ce0e56a6bf62e2e429d68d9e60d8f8df0703e87d87:7

value
291373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 428b8ed5a9901ed59f3991b92933da2f4e6bfb55 OP_EQUAL
address
37kshrsrwrsg4raJtevumZ1a5YgVY87kB2
transaction
893bc2196c58cbaf14c616ce0e56a6bf62e2e429d68d9e60d8f8df0703e87d87
spent
true